IN RE RAY

No. 05-98-00028-CV.

967 S.W.2d 951 (1998)

In re Brenda RAY, Relator.

Court of Appeals of Texas, Dallas.

April 29, 1998.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Andrew Korn, Andrew Korn, P.C., Dallas, John Whitney Bowdich, Dallas, Brad Jackson, Jackson & Matthews, Dallas, for Relator.

Ed Huddleston, Lynn Marie Johnson, Law, Snakard & Gambill, Fort Worth, for Real Party in Interest.

Before KINKEADE, WHITTINGTON and BRIDGES, JJ.


OPINION AND ORDER

WHITTINGTON, Justice.

In this mandamus proceeding, relator seeks an order directing the trial court to enter a finding showing the date on which relator or her attorney first received notice or acquired actual knowledge of the trial court's dismissal order.
